NEW YORK (Reuters) – U.S. prosecutors have charged three members of an Jap European felony group which has ties to Iran’s authorities with conspiring to assassinate a journalist and activist who’s a U.S. citizen, Legal professional Normal Merrick Garland stated on Friday.
Rafat Amirov, Polad Omarov and Khalid Mehdiyev had been charged with murder-for-hire and cash laundering for his or her function within the thwarted Tehran-backed plot, the Division of Justice stated in a press release.
“The sufferer publicized (the) Iranian authorities’s human rights abuses, discriminatory remedy of girls, suppression of democratic participation and expression and use of arbitrary imprisonment, torture and execution,” Garland stated.
Garland didn’t title the alleged sufferer, however Mehdiyev was arrested final yr in New York for having a rifle outdoors the Brooklyn residence of journalist Masih Alinejad, a longtime critic of Iran’s head-covering legal guidelines who has promoted movies of girls violating these legal guidelines on social media.
Mehdiyev pleaded not responsible to at least one depend of possessing a firearm with an obliterated serial quantity. He’s being held at Brooklyn’s Metropolitan Detention Heart pending trial.
Iran’s mission to the United Nations didn’t instantly reply to a request for remark.
U.S. prosecutors in 2021 charged 4 Iranians alleged to be intelligence operatives for Tehran with plotting to kidnap a New York-based journalist and activist. Whereas the goal of the plot was not named, Reuters confirmed she was Alinejad.
Amirov was arrested on Thursday and can have a pretrial listening to in federal courtroom in Manhattan afterward Friday. Omarov was arrested within the Czech Republic earlier this month, and the USA is in search of his extradition.
The USA in 2011 arrested one man it stated was linked to an Iranian plot to assassinate the Saudi Arabian ambassador to Washington on the time at a restaurant he frequented within the capital.
Washington accuses Tehran of backing terrorism and pursuing nuclear arms, expenses Iran denies.
